- /******************************************************************************
- * SD/MMC card controller
- ******************************************************************************/
- static int palmld_mci_init(struct device *dev, irq_handler_t palmld_detect_int,
- void *data)
- {
- int err = 0;
- /* Setup an interrupt for detecting card insert/remove events */
- err = gpio_request(GPIO_NR_PALMLD_SD_DETECT_N, "SD IRQ");
- if (err)
- goto err;
- err = gpio_direction_input(GPIO_NR_PALMLD_SD_DETECT_N);
- if (err)
- goto err2;
- err = request_irq(gpio_to_irq(GPIO_NR_PALMLD_SD_DETECT_N),
- palmld_detect_int, IRQF_DISABLED | IRQF_SAMPLE_RANDOM |
- IRQF_TRIGGER_FALLING | IRQF_TRIGGER_RISING,
- "SD/MMC card detect", data);
- if (err) {
- printk(KERN_ERR "%s: cannot request SD/MMC card detect IRQ\n",
- __func__);
- goto err2;
- }
- err = gpio_request(GPIO_NR_PALMLD_SD_POWER, "SD_POWER");
- if (err)
- goto err3;
- err = gpio_direction_output(GPIO_NR_PALMLD_SD_POWER, 0);
- if (err)
- goto err4;
- err = gpio_request(GPIO_NR_PALMLD_SD_READONLY, "SD_READONLY");
- if (err)
- goto err4;
- err = gpio_direction_input(GPIO_NR_PALMLD_SD_READONLY);
- if (err)
- goto err5;
- printk(KERN_DEBUG "%s: irq registered\n", __func__);
- return 0;
- err5:
- gpio_free(GPIO_NR_PALMLD_SD_READONLY);
- err4:
- gpio_free(GPIO_NR_PALMLD_SD_POWER);
- err3:
- free_irq(gpio_to_irq(GPIO_NR_PALMLD_SD_DETECT_N), data);
- err2:
- gpio_free(GPIO_NR_PALMLD_SD_DETECT_N);
- err:
- return err;
- }
- static void palmld_mci_exit(struct device *dev, void *data)
- {
- gpio_free(GPIO_NR_PALMLD_SD_READONLY);
- gpio_free(GPIO_NR_PALMLD_SD_POWER);
- free_irq(gpio_to_irq(GPIO_NR_PALMLD_SD_DETECT_N), data);
- gpio_free(GPIO_NR_PALMLD_SD_DETECT_N);
- }
- static void palmld_mci_power(struct device *dev, unsigned int vdd)
- {
- struct pxamci_platform_data *p_d = dev->platform_data;
- gpio_set_value(GPIO_NR_PALMLD_SD_POWER, p_d->ocr_mask & (1 << vdd));
- }
- static int palmld_mci_get_ro(struct device *dev)
- {
- return gpio_get_value(GPIO_NR_PALMLD_SD_READONLY);
- }
- static struct pxamci_platform_data palmld_mci_platform_data = {
- .ocr_mask = MMC_VDD_32_33 | MMC_VDD_33_34,
- .setpower = palmld_mci_power,
- .get_ro = palmld_mci_get_ro,
- .init = palmld_mci_init,
- .exit = palmld_mci_exit,
- };

- /******************************************************************************
- * Power management - standby
- ******************************************************************************/
- #ifdef CONFIG_PM
- static u32 *addr __initdata;
- static u32 resume[3] __initdata = {
- 0xe3a00101, /* mov r0, #0x40000000 */
- 0xe380060f, /* orr r0, r0, #0x00f00000 */
- 0xe590f008, /* ldr pc, [r0, #0x08] */
- };
- static int __init palmld_pm_init(void)
- {
- int i;
- /* this is where the bootloader jumps */
- addr = phys_to_virt(PALMLD_STR_BASE);
- for (i = 0; i < 3; i++)
- addr[i] = resume[i];
- return 0;
- }
- device_initcall(palmld_pm_init);
- #endif
